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64281720614 11826888 65649796 0865427328 8597289519
56077328195 65
56077328195 65
945 9509434899 87 69073538145
All about undefined
Interested in learning more?
56077328195 65
945 9509434899 87 69073538145
See more
3535 000265049
7187 5247599432 32498073
See more
75023 1525581 1926657
21565 52386 022992 2784
See more